Factors Affecting the Price of a MacBook Air Charger
The cost of a MacBook Air charger can vary based on several factors:
- Brand: Original Apple chargers are generally more expensive than compatible third-party options.
- Quality: Higher-quality chargers with durable materials and sturdy construction tend to cost more.
- Features: Chargers with additional features like fast charging or multiple ports may be priced higher.
- Connector Type: Chargers with a magnetic MagSafe connector (older models) or a USB-C connector (newer models) have different pricing.
- Wattage: Chargers with higher wattage (e.g., 30W, 60W) handle more power and may come at a higher cost.
How to Choose the Right MacBook Air Charger
Consider these points when selecting a MacBook Air charger:
- Compatibility: Ensure the charger is compatible with your specific MacBook Air model.
- Connector Type: Choose a charger with the right connector type (MagSafe or USB-C).
- Wattage: Select a charger with sufficient wattage to meet your power needs.
- Quality: Opt for a high-quality charger with good construction and safety features.
- Brand: Decide whether you prefer an original Apple charger or a compatible third-party option.
